Systematic name | YMR080C |
Gene name | NAM7 |
Aliases | IFS2, MOF4, SUP113, UPF1 |
Feature type | ORF, Verified |
Coordinates | Chr XIII:429627..426712 |
Primary SGDID | S000004685 |
Description of YMR080C: ATP-dependent RNA helicase of the SFI superfamily involved in nonsense mediated mRNA decay; required for efficient translation termination at nonsense codons and targeting of NMD substrates to P-bodies; involved in telomere maintenance[1][2][3][4]

Interactions
Two Hybrid
Two Hybrid interaction with SNP1, NMD3, DBP2, NMD4, DCP2, NMD5, NMD2
Yeast Two-Hybrid screen with Upf1p as bait identified several interacting proteins [5] [6]
